What Is Ozempic and Semaglutide? An Overview

Ozempic is a brand-name medication that contains the active ingredient semaglutide. Semaglutide is a gl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) receptor agonist, a class of drugs celebrated for their role in managing type 2 diabetes and BMI reduction. Recognized for its potent appetite-suppressing and blood sugar-lowering properties, semaglutide has become an integral part of treatment plans worldwide.

When we ask "ozempic same as semaglutide", we're emphasizing that Ozempic is essentially a branded form of the active compound semaglutide, often distinguished from other generic formulations or different brands utilizing semaglutide's benefits. This equivalence allows healthcare professionals and consumers to understand that therapeutic effects observed with Ozempic are attributable directly to semaglutide’s mechanism of action.

The Science Behind Semaglutide and Its Effectiveness

Semaglutide works by mimicking the functions of GLP-1, a hormone that regulates insulin secretion, appetite, and gastric emptying. Its ability to selectively stimulate GLP-1 receptors results in lower blood glucose levels and suppressed hunger signals. This dual action makes semaglutide an exceptional tool for:

  • Improving glycemic control in type 2 diabetes
  • Supporting weight loss in obese individuals
  • Reducing cardiovascular risk factors associated with diabetes

The long-acting nature of semaglutide allows for weekly dosing, enhancing patient adherence and optimizing therapeutic outcomes.

Ozempic Same as Semaglutide: Forms, Dosage, and Administration

Ozempic and other semaglutide-based medications are available in pen-injector forms, designed for ease of use and consistent dosing. The typical regimen involves weekly injections, tailored to the patient's medical needs and body response.

These medications come in various dosages, commonly ranging from 0.5 mg to 2 mg weekly, with some formulations specially designed for weight management programs such as Wegovy, which uses higher doses of semaglutide.

Proper administration and adherence to prescribed dosage are crucial for achieving optimal blood sugar control and weight loss metrics.

Understanding the Advantages of Semaglutide-Based Medications in Healthcare

The rising popularity of semaglutide stem from numerous advantages, including:

  • Enhanced glycemic control: Significantly reduces HbA1c levels
  • Effective weight loss: Clinically proven for substantial weight reduction
  • Cardiovascular benefits: Demonstrates reduction in heart-related events
  • Convenient dosing schedule: Weekly administration improves compliance

These benefits make semaglutide a versatile solution not just for diabetes but also as a tool in tackling the global obesity epidemic.

Key Considerations and Precautions

While semaglutide and Ozempic offer remarkable benefits, they are not suitable for everyone. Important precautions include:

  • History of medullary thyroid carcinoma
  • Multiple endocrine neoplasia syndrome type 2
  • Pregnancy or breastfeeding
  • History of pancreatitis

Consulting healthcare providers before initiating therapy ensures safety and optimal outcomes.
